But what if Santa actually wrote back? The United States Postal Service is now offering "Letters From Santa," a program that allows any person to play Santa by sending a letter signed by Saint Nick to any child.
According to a postal service news release, "The Letters From Santa program helps parents fulfill the dreams of their own children."
Instructions to send a letter from Santa:
- Write a letter to your child from Santa Claus and sign it "From Santa." Put the letter in an envelope addressed to your child with the return address SANTA, NORTH POLE.
- Ensure a First-Class Mail stamp is affixed to the envelope.
- Place the envelope into a larger envelope, with appropriate postage, and address the larger envelope to:NORTH POLE POSTMARK
POSTMASTER
4141 POSTMARK DR
ANCHORAGE AK 99530-9998 - Your letter from Santa will be mailed back to your child, postmarked from the North Pole.
- “Letters From Santa” must be mailed to the Anchorage, AK postmaster by no later than Dec. 10. Santa’s helpers in Anchorage will take care of the rest.
